Potential negative consequences of COVID-19 for mental health for the General Public
- Most surveys of the general public show increased symptoms of depression, anxiety, and stress related to COVID-19
- There have been reports of phobic anxiety, panic buying, and binge-watching television
- social media exposure has been associated with increased odds of anxiety and combined depression with anxiety
- May increase risky behavior (e.g. online gambling)
- Increased alcohol sales and alcohol use in the home may increase alcohol use disorders and domestic violence
- increased risk of physical and sexual abuse at home during the pandemic
- In places with scarce resources, the pandemic could also exacerbate mental health conditions and further limit health services
